大一c语言上机实验题目
“大一c语言上机实验题目”相关的资料有哪些?“大一c语言上机实验题目”相关的范文有哪些?怎么写?下面是小编为您精心整理的“大一c语言上机实验题目”相关范文大全或资料大全,欢迎大家分享。
C语言培训上机实验题目
安装Visual C ++6.0
下载
请从群里下载Microsoft Visual Studio.rar。
将下载的文件Microsoft Visual Studio.rar解压后即可使用。
请直接运行文件“Microsoft Visual Studio\\Common\\MSDev98\\Bin\\MSDEV.EXE”
实验一 认识C语言
【实验目的】
1.熟悉C程序设计编程环境 Visual C ++,掌握运行一个C程序设计的基本步骤,包括编辑、编译、连接和运行。
编辑:编写源程序文件.c 编译:生成目标文件.obj 连接:生成可执行文件.exe 运行:执行.exe文件。
2.掌握C语言程序设计的基本框架,能够编写简单的C程序。 3.了解程序调试的思想,能找出并改正C程序中的语法错误。
【实验内容】
1-1 在磁盘上新建一个文件夹,用于存放C程序,文件夹的名字可以是学号,如 D:\\3050888。
1-2 编程示例,在屏幕上显示一个短句“Hello World!”。
源程序
# include printf(\} 运行结果 Hello World! 作为第一个实验,在Visual
C语言上机题目
重庆市计算机等级考试C语言上机模拟试题
1、 函数adddigit的原型为int adddigit(int num);,其功能是
求num各位数字之和。要求编制该函数并用如下所示的主函数进行测试,源程序存入test1.c。
# include “stdio.h” # include “math.h” void main()
{ int adddigit(int num); int n;
scanf(“%d”,&n);
printf(“sum=%d\\n”,adddigit(n));
}
2、 编制程序输出如下所示图形,源程序存入test11.c。 1 121 12321 1234321 123454321 12345654321
3、 编制程
C语言上机题目汇总
“C语言”上机题目汇总
2012-2013-2
1. 输入三角形两个边长及其夹角(角度值),求第三边边长和三角型面积。 2. 输入一个字符,若是小写字母,则转换成大写字母输出;若是大写字母,则转换成小写字母输出。
3. 输入一个大写字母,输出字母表中它前面的字母和后面的字母。如果输入的字母为A或Z,则分别输出提示信息“没有前面的字母”或“没有后面的字母”。
4. 编写程序,输入一个整数,判断它能否被3、5、7整除,并根据情况输出下列信息:
(1) 能同时被3、5、7整除。
(2) 能同时被3、5、7中的两个数整除,并输出这两个数。 (3) 只能被3、5、7中的一个数整除,输出该数。 (4) 不能被3、5、7中的任何一个数整除。
1115. 已知正整数A>B>C且A+B+C<100,求满足2+2=2共有多少组,并输出
ABC满足条件的组合。
1111116. 求1+++++++的值,直到最后一项的值小于10-5。
2471116221a7. 用迭代法求某数a的平方根,已知求平方根的迭代公式为:xn=(xn-1+)。
2xn-1a取为迭代初值,迭代的结束条件取xn-xn-1£10-5。 28. 分别输出100以内(不包括100)所有偶数的和与所有奇数的和。 9. 利用嵌套循环输出以下图形(行与
C语言上机实验
实验一(第1章实验)
实验目的:
1. 掌握运行C语言程序的全过程。 2. 熟悉编译环境。
3. 初步熟悉C语言程序的语法规定。 4. 了解简单函数的使用方法。 实验内容:
1. 编程且上机运行:求3个整数的和。
2. 编程且上机运行:求2个数的和、差、积和商。 3. 编程且上机运行:输入3个数,求最大值。
4. 编程且上机运行:输入圆的半径,求圆的面积和周长。 5. 在屏幕上输出:“hello world!” 实验结果:
实验二(第3章实验)
1.
实验目的:理解C语言的类型系统。
实验内容:写程序测试数据 -2在类型char,int,unsigned int,long int,unsigned long int中存储情况。 实验过程:
实验结果:参见各种类型的存储实现描述。
2.
实验目的:了解混合类型计算中类型的转换规则。
实验内容:写程序测试多种类型数据一起运算时类型的转换及表达式结果的类型。注意unsigned int和 int数据运算时类型转换的方向。 实验过程:
/*
* 类型转换问题
* 试问下面两个表达式等价吗? */
#include unsigned int ui,
C语言上机实验 答案
实验一 上机操作初步(2学时)
一、实验方式:一人一机 二、实验目的:
1、熟悉VC++语言的上机环境及上机操作过程。 2、了解如何编辑、编译、连接和运行一个C程序。 3、初步了解C程序的特点。 三、实验内容:
说明:前三题为必做题目,后两题为选做题目。
1、输出入下信息:(实验指导书P79)
*************************
Very Good
************************* 2、计算两个整数的和与积。(实验指导书P81)
3、从键盘输入一个角度的弧度值x,计算该角度的余弦值,将计算结果输出到屏幕。(书P3)
4、在屏幕上显示一个文字菜单模样的图案:
================================= 1 输入数据 2 修改数据 3 查询数据 4 打印数据 ================================= 5、从键盘上输入两个整数,交
c语言上机实验题
1.下列程序中,要求main函数实现如下功能:从键盘上输入三个正整数,求出它们中的最大值。请完善程序,并在程序最后用注释的方式给出你的测试数据及在这组测试数据下的运行结果。
#include { int a,b,c,max; printf(\ scanf(\ if(a>b) max=a; else max=b if(c>max) max=c; printf(\ %d\} /*1,2,5 max of the three numbers is 5*/ 2.请编程序,对从键盘上输入的x值,根据以下函数关系计算出相应的y值(设x,y均为整型量)。 x x<0 0<=x<10 10<=x<20 20<=x<40 #include int x,y; scanf(\ if(x<0) y=0; else if(x>=0&&x<=10) y=x; else if(x>=10&&x y 0 x 10 -5x+20 3. 写程序计算下列各表达式的值: 1)1?2 3?4/513?(2.24?0.242)22) 3.683)2?13?e2 #include
C语言上机实验 答案
实验一 上机操作初步(2学时)
一、实验方式:一人一机 二、实验目的:
1、熟悉VC++语言的上机环境及上机操作过程。 2、了解如何编辑、编译、连接和运行一个C程序。 3、初步了解C程序的特点。 三、实验内容:
说明:前三题为必做题目,后两题为选做题目。
1、输出入下信息:(实验指导书P79)
*************************
Very Good
************************* 2、计算两个整数的和与积。(实验指导书P81)
3、从键盘输入一个角度的弧度值x,计算该角度的余弦值,将计算结果输出到屏幕。(书P3)
4、在屏幕上显示一个文字菜单模样的图案:
================================= 1 输入数据 2 修改数据 3 查询数据 4 打印数据 ================================= 5、从键盘上输入两个整数,交
C语言上机题目 珍藏版
【编程 1-3】编写程序输入圆柱体的底面半径radius和高度height,计算并输出圆柱体的表面积S和体积V。
要求:把π定义为宏PI,结果保留2位小数,按下列格式输出: Radius=???.?? Area=??
volumn=???.??
#include float radius; float height; float S; float V; printf(\请输入圆柱体的底面半径:\ scanf(\ printf(\请输入高度:\ scanf(\ S=2*PI*radius*radius+2*PI*radius*height; V=PI*radius*radius*height; printf(\ printf(\ printf(\} 【编程 2-3】若某企业根据销售人员的销售额发放提成,计算公式如下(s代表销售额): s<200 没有提成 200≤s<400 提成5% 400≤s<1200 提成8% 1200≤s<2400 提成8% 2400≤s<4000 提成8% s≥4000 请分别使用if和switch语句结构分别编写程序,实现从键盘上输入销售额,即输出销售额和提成。要求程序具有纠错能力,如输入负数就输出非法数据的提示信息并结束程序。 if…else-if语句 #inc
C语言实验题目
C语言程序设计实验进阶题目
实验一 分支语句
实验目的:掌握使用if~else语句和switch~case语句实现分支结构的方法。
实验内容:
1.求出下面分段函数的值
x?0?0?y=?x0?x?10 ?2x?1x?10? 要求:(1)使用if~else语句 (2)x的值从键盘输入
2.运输公司对用户计算运费。距离越远,每公里运费越低,标准如下: s<250km 无折扣 250<=s<500 2%折扣 500<=s<1000 5%折扣 1000<=s<2000 8%折扣 2000<=s<3000 10%折扣 3000<=s 15%折扣
设每公里每吨货物的基本运费为p,货物重为w,距离为s,折扣为d,则总运费计算公式为:f=p*w*s*(1-d),编写程序计算运费。
要求:(1)使用switch~case语句。 (2)p、w、s的值从键盘输入。
实验二 循环语句
实验目的:掌握使用三种循环语句实现循环结构的方法。 实验内容:
1.猴子吃桃问题。猴子第一天摘下若干个桃子,当即吃了一半另一个,以后每天早晨都吃剩下的一半另一个,到第十天早晨再想吃时,就剩一个桃子。问第一天共摘了多少桃子。
要求:分别用三种语句编写程序。
2.编写程序验证下列结论:任何一个自然数n的立方都等于n个连续奇数之和。例如:13=1;23=3+5;33=7+9+11。
要求:程序对每个输入的自然数计算
大学大一c语言程序设计实验室上机题全部代码答案(实验报告)
C语言实验报告
实验1-1:
hello world程序: 源代码:
#include printf(\ system(\ } 实验1-2: 完成3个数据的输入、求和并输出计算结果的程序: 源代码: #include int i,j,k,sum; scanf(\ sum=i+j+k; printf(\ system(\ 实验1-3: 在屏幕上输出如下图形: A BBB CCCCC 源代码: #include printf(\ A\\n\ printf(\ BBB\\n\ printf(\ system(\ } 实验2-1: 计算由键盘输入的任何两个双精度数据的平均值 源代码: #include main() { double a,b; scanf(\ printf(\ system(\ } 实验2-2: 写一个输入7个数据的程